Abstract

The present invention relates to a virtual reality Training system for comprehensive geriatric assessment, so that users can obtain a live experience through the virtual reality, and through continuous simulation exercises, the overall learning effect and the purpose of practical application are improved.

以下僅以實施例說明本發明可能之實施態樣,然並非用以限制本發明所欲保護之範疇,合先敘明。 The following examples illustrate possible implementations of the present invention, but are not intended to limit the scope of protection of the present invention.

請參考圖1至11,其顯示本發明之一較佳實施例,本發明之老人周全性評估之虛擬實境訓練系統包括一系統建構單元1及一虛擬實境單元3。 Please refer to FIGS. 1 to 11 , which show a preferred embodiment of the present invention. The virtual reality training system for comprehensive evaluation of the elderly of the present invention includes a system construction unit 1 and a virtual reality unit 3 .

該系統建構單元1包含有一虛擬受測者設定模組11、一虛擬環境資料12、一提問腳本13、一評估表資料14及一訓練流程2,該虛擬受測者設定模組11包含有一認知功能待檢測項目15及身體活動功能待檢測項目16,該認知功能待檢測項目15預設有複數認知功能腳本151,該身體活動功能待檢測項目16預設有複數身體活動功能腳本161,該提問腳本13包括複數關鍵字131。 The system construction unit 1 includes a virtual test subject setting module 11, a virtual environment data 12, a question script 13, an evaluation table data 14 and a training process 2, and the virtual test subject setting module 11 includes a cognition The function to be detected item 15 and the physical activity function to be detected item 16, the cognitive function to be detected item 15 is preset with a plurality of cognitive function scripts 151, the physical activity function to be detected item 16 is preset with a plurality of physical activity function scripts 161, the question The script 13 includes plural keywords 131 .

該虛擬實境單元3包含有一手部感應器31、一處理單元32、一顯示單元33及一語音辨識單元34,該手部感應器31供配戴於使用者之手部以偵測手部動作及位置,該處理單元32通訊連接該手部感應器31並將所偵測之手部動作及位置運算後傳遞予該顯示單元33以同步顯示出一虛擬手部41,該處理單元32通訊連接該系統建構單元1並將設定後該虛擬受測者設定模組11、該虛擬環境資料12、該評估表資料14遞予該顯示單元33以顯示出一虛擬受測者42、一虛擬環境43、一周全性評估表44,該虛擬受測者42、該虛擬環境43、該周全性評估表44定義為一互動單元,該處理單元32透過該虛擬手部41與該互動單元之相對位置及動作判斷出一操作狀態,進而該處理單元32令該互動單元產生與該操作狀態相匹配之變化並顯示於該顯示單元33,以達到實境與虛擬互動之目的。該語音辨識單元34通訊連接該處理單元32,該語音辨識單元34傳遞一即時音訊資料予該處理單元32,該處理單元32比對該即時音訊資料及該等關鍵字131,當該處理單元32判斷出該即時音訊資料包含有一該關鍵字131時,該處理單元32令該虛擬受測者42依據該虛擬受測者設定模組11之設定狀態回應出與該關鍵字131相匹配之該認知功能腳本151與該身體活動功能腳本161其中一者。 The virtual reality unit 3 includes a hand sensor 31, a processing unit 32, a display unit 33, and a voice recognition unit 34. The hand sensor 31 is worn on the user's hand to detect the hand Action and position, the processing unit 32 communicates with the hand sensor 31 and transmits the detected hand action and position calculation to the display unit 33 to simultaneously display a virtual hand 41, the processing unit 32 communicates Connect the system construction unit 1 and deliver the virtual subject setting module 11, the virtual environment data 12, and the evaluation form data 14 to the display unit 33 after setting to display a virtual subject 42 and a virtual environment 43. A comprehensive assessment form 44, the virtual subject 42, the virtual environment 43, and the comprehensive assessment form 44 are defined as an interactive unit, and the processing unit 32 uses the relative position of the virtual hand 41 and the interactive unit And the action determines an operation state, and then the processing unit 32 causes the interaction unit to generate a change matching the operation state and display it on the display unit 33, so as to achieve the purpose of real-world and virtual interaction. The speech recognition unit 34 is communicatively connected to the processing unit 32, the speech recognition unit 34 transmits an instant audio data to the processing unit 32, and the processing unit 32 compares the instant audio data and the keywords 131, when the processing unit 32 When judging that the real-time audio data contains a keyword 131, the processing unit 32 makes the virtual subject 42 respond to the cognition matching the keyword 131 according to the setting state of the virtual subject setting module 11. One of the functional script 151 and the physical activity functional script 161 .

其中,該訓練流程2包含有一種類選擇步驟21及一評估步驟22,該種類選擇步驟21用以選擇該認知功能待檢測項目15及該身體活動功能待檢測項 目16其中一者進行,該評估步驟22為分析該認知功能待檢測項目15及該身體活動功能待檢測項目16其中一者之能力狀態23。 Wherein, the training process 2 includes a category selection step 21 and an evaluation step 22, the category selection step 21 is used to select the cognitive function to be detected item 15 and the physical activity function to be detected item One of the items 16 is performed, and the evaluation step 22 is to analyze the ability state 23 of one of the cognitive function to be detected item 15 and the physical activity function to be detected item 16 .

進一步的說,該虛擬實境單元3另包含有一播音單元35,該播音單元35通訊連接該處理單元32以播放該認知功能腳本151與該身體活動功能腳本161其中一者,以讓使用者與該虛擬受測者42之間產生互動對話感。 Furthermore, the virtual reality unit 3 further includes a broadcast unit 35, which is communicatively connected to the processing unit 32 to play one of the cognitive function script 151 and the physical activity function script 161, so that the user and A sense of interactive dialogue is generated between the virtual subjects 42 .

於本實施例中該系統建構單元1另包含有一首頁資料17,該顯示單元33依據該首頁資料17顯示出一該首頁資料17,該首頁資料17包含有一使用單位171、一使用編號172、一使用者代稱173。如此可以清楚的對所有使用者進行分門別類,且可針對不同該使用單元進行客製化內容。 In this embodiment, the system construction unit 1 further includes a home page data 17, and the display unit 33 displays a home page data 17 according to the home page data 17, and the home page data 17 includes a user unit 171, a use number 172, a The user code name is 173. In this way, all users can be clearly categorized, and customized content can be carried out for different usage units.

較佳地,該系統建構單元1另包含有一評分模組18,該評分模組18接收來自該處理單元32傳遞之資料進而判斷使用者是否依循該訓練流程2及正確性,進而生成一評分表5傳遞予該顯示單元33中。 Preferably, the system construction unit 1 further includes a scoring module 18, the scoring module 18 receives the data transmitted from the processing unit 32 and then judges whether the user follows the training process 2 and correctness, and then generates a scoring table 5 is transmitted to the display unit 33.

其中,該評分模組18係針對複數評分項目181分別進行評分,該複數評分項目181之分數51可進行調整改變。因此,此套系統若用於學校時,設定值可交由老師來進行設定。 Wherein, the scoring module 18 performs scoring on the multiple scoring items 181 respectively, and the scores 51 of the multiple scoring items 181 can be adjusted and changed. Therefore, if this system is used in a school, the setting value can be set by the teacher.

於本實施例中該虛擬實境單元3係為頭戴式裝置,該顯示單元33另會將該認知功能腳本151與該身體活動功能腳本161以字幕方式顯示出來,以便使用者能透過目視、耳聽等不同方式來接收訊息,於其它實施例中該虛擬實境單元3亦可為電腦。 In this embodiment, the virtual reality unit 3 is a head-mounted device, and the display unit 33 will also display the cognitive function script 151 and the physical activity function script 161 in the form of subtitles, so that the user can visually, Listening and other different ways to receive information, in other embodiments, the virtual reality unit 3 can also be a computer.

具體而言,該身體活動功能腳本161包括上街購物、外出活動、食物烹調、家務維持、洗衣服、使用電話、服用藥物、處理財務能力等至少其中一者,該能力狀態23分成0、1、2、3、4級,使用者依據該身體活動功能腳本161 之內容判斷符合哪個數字等級進行評估,舉例來說,當使用者說出問句,該語音辨識單元34將問句轉換成即時音訊資料,該處理單元32辨識出關鍵字131「出門」時,該身體活動功能腳本161即播放出相對應之有關外出活動之腳本(如圖7、8所示)。該認知功能腳本151包括對活動和嗜好的興趣降低、重複相同的問題、使用工具障礙、處理財務能力等至少其中一者,該能力狀態23分成是與否,使用者依據該認知功能腳本151之內容判斷是否改變認知功能進行評估,舉例來說,當使用者說出問句,該語音辨識單元34將問句轉換成即時音訊資料,該處理單元32辨識出關鍵字131「興趣」時,該認知功能腳本151即播放出相對應之有關興趣的腳本(如圖9、10所示)。 Specifically, the physical activity function script 161 includes at least one of shopping, going out, food cooking, housework maintenance, washing clothes, using the phone, taking medicine, handling financial ability, etc., and the ability status 23 is divided into 0 and 1. , Level 2, 3, and 4, the user follows the physical activity function script 161 The content judges which digital grade matches the evaluation. For example, when the user speaks a question, the voice recognition unit 34 converts the question into instant audio data. When the processing unit 32 recognizes the keyword 131 "going out", The body activity function script 161 plays the corresponding script about going out (as shown in FIGS. 7 and 8 ). The cognitive function script 151 includes at least one of reduced interest in activities and hobbies, repeated same questions, tool use barriers, and ability to handle finances. Whether the content judgment changes the cognitive function is evaluated. For example, when the user speaks a question sentence, the speech recognition unit 34 converts the question sentence into real-time audio data, and when the processing unit 32 recognizes the keyword 131 "interest", the The cognitive function script 151 then plays the corresponding interest-related script (as shown in FIGS. 9 and 10 ).

另外,該訓練流程2另包含有一就醫建議步驟,該就醫建議步驟根據該能力狀態23而提供進一步就醫診斷之建議24。 In addition, the training process 2 further includes a step of seeking medical advice, and the step of seeking medical advice provides a suggestion 24 for further medical diagnosis according to the ability state 23 .

值得一提的是,該評分表5包含有一分數51及一提醒區52,該提醒區52用以成列出未達標的該評分項目181。該分數51可進行紀錄而讓使用者透過歷史資訊來了解自我是否有進步,該提醒區52用以成列出未達標的該評分項目181,以便於讓使用者操作完畢後能夠立即得知何處有缺失,進而於下次改進。於本實施例中,該評分模組18係針對複數評分項目181分別進行評分,該複數評分項目181之分數51可進行調整改變以供不同個案使用。 It is worth mentioning that the scoring table 5 includes a score 51 and a reminder area 52 , and the reminder area 52 is used to list the scoring items 181 that do not meet the standard. The score 51 can be recorded so that the user can know whether he has improved through historical information, and the reminder area 52 is used to list the scoring items 181 that have not reached the standard, so that the user can know immediately after the operation is completed. There are deficiencies, and then it will be improved next time. In this embodiment, the scoring module 18 performs scoring on the multiple scoring items 181 respectively, and the scores 51 of the multiple scoring items 181 can be adjusted and changed for use in different cases.
